Hengchun ballads to ring in Houston night

A "land-sound-scape” performance in the spirit of traditional Taiwanese music and poetry will be held at the Asia Society Texas Center on Nov. 6.


"From Taiwan's Hengchun Township to the Stage” features Jen Shyu (徐秋雁), a multi-talented vocalist of Taiwanese and East Timorese heritage, a Stanford graduate and Fulbright scholar, and a cultural ambassador of folksongs from Taiwan's Hengchun County.


The two-hour concert will include folksongs inspired by iconic Hengchun folksinger and storyteller Chen Da (陳達), whose performances were characterized by spontaneity and the playing of Taiwanese moon zither (月琴).


Shyu will also perform her own inventive arrangements, some of which are set to poems by her late mentor, Taiwanese poet Edward Te-chang Cheng (鄭德昌).
